February Origin and Meaning
The name February is a boy's name meaning "purification feast".
If January, April and August are useable and fashionable, why not February? February as a word derives from the Latin februa, which was the name of a purification feast coming at the end of winter, to prepare for the coming spring.
For our part, we like February along with December and January as names for winter babies; we also like the possibility of Airy and Rue as nicknames.
A possible stumbling block, however, is that clumsy "bruary" sound in the middle that no one ever quite gets right.
